Frequently Asked Questions
Can I make this recipe ahead of time? Yes, you can cook the oatmeal ahead of time and store it in the fridge for up to 3 days. Just reheat it with a splash of water or milk before serving.

Can I use other types of seeds? Absolutely! You can swap out the pumpkin seeds for sunflower seeds or add flaxseeds for a nutritional boost.

Can I make this oatmeal without banana? Yes, you can substitute the banana with other fruits like berries, apples, or even dried fruit like raisins or figs.

Can I use maple syrup instead of vanilla sugar? Yes, maple syrup can be used as a natural sweetener. Just drizzle it over the top or mix it into the oatmeal for added sweetness.

Can I make this recipe vegan? Yes, simply use plant-based milk (like almond or oat milk) and ensure the seeds and nuts are raw or roasted without any animal-based ingredients.
